What you will do:

Operations Manager will be responsible for all aspects of project delivery within our Major Project team. You will lead a team of project managers, framework coordinators & construction managers to deliver project and business objectives within your portfolio. The successful candidate will form a strong working relationship with our client team and supply chain partners, pivotal in driving both EHS and Quality measures within a growing business.

Our Major project delivery typically work within the Healthcare or Rail sector. This is a varied role, covering all the UK leading a geographically spread team.

How you will do it:

  • Lead your team in the delivery of large scale programmes of work
  • Manage and coordinate a team of project managers, engineers, frameworks coordinators and construction managers, engage with supply chain partners
  • Responsible for building long term strategic relationship with client and supply chain partners
  • You will be the escalation contact for projects within your portfolio, assisting your team and clients in problem solving and resolution.
  • Conduct regular safety and quality audits on site with your team
  • Monitor Environmental, Health & Safety performance within the group
  • Ensure compliance with CDM regulations, method statements, risk assessments, COSHH and EHS process
  • You will take P&L ownership of projects within your portfolio
  • Provide support and guidance to your team in developing and maintaining project programmes
  • Build a close working relationship with the sales division
  • Contribute to regular operational reviews
  • Conduct regular business reviews

What we look for:                                                        

Required:

  • Min. 5 Year’s Project / Operational Management experience in the construction industry, with a strong M&E background
  • Ability to manage both internal & external stakeholders
  • Excellent verbal and written communication
  • Proficient at analysing data to make informed decisions
  • Experience working across multiple project with multiple stakeholders
  • Demonstrate strong leadership capabilities
  • Strong people skills
  • High level of commercial acumen, with responsibility of managing a P&L withing a large organisation
  • Experience of managing H&S in a construction environment
  • Willingness to travel throughout the UK approx. 20% of the time

Preferable:

  • Knowledge of decarbonisation measures (e.g. installation of ASHPs, Solar PV, LED lighting and BMS Optimisation)
  • Experience working within healthcare or rail sector
  • Experienced within the Building Services industry, familiar with processes required in installing various mechanical, electrical and fabric measures
